Applied Biosystems™ TaqMan™ Multiplex Master Mix is a high-performance, 2X concentrated real-time PCR master mix designed to simultaneously amplify up to four targets in a single reaction. This master mix is optimized for gene expression and genotyping experiments, ensuring fast run times (<40 minutes), superior sensitivity, and high specificity.

It contains AmpliTaq™ Fast DNA Polymerase, uracil-N glycosylase (UNG) for carry-over contamination control, dNTPs with dUTP, MUSTANG PURPLE™ dye (passive reference), and an optimized buffer system. It is fully validated with TaqMan™ assays and TaqMan™ QSY™ probes, offering seamless integration into qPCR workflows.

Product Specifications

FeatureDetails
Product NameTaqMan™ Multiplex Master Mix
Catalog Numbers4486295 (50 mL), 4461881 (1 mL), 4461882 (5 mL), 4461884 (2 × 5 mL), 4484262 (5 × 5 mL), 4484263 (10 × 5 mL)
PolymeraseAmpliTaq™ Fast DNA Polymerase
PCR MethodMultiplex qPCR
Reaction SpeedFast
Detection MethodPrimer-probe (TaqMan™ assays)
GC-Rich PCR PerformanceHigh
Concentration2X
Passive Reference DyeMUSTANG PURPLE™
Carry-Over PreventionUracil-N Glycosylase (UNG)
Fidelity (vs. Taq Polymerase)2X
Sample TypeDNA
Unit SizeEach
Storage Conditions2–8°C (Refrigerated)
Shelf LifeLong-term stability under recommended storage conditions

Storage & Handling Instructions

  • Storage Conditions:
    • Keep at 2–8°C (Refrigerated); DO NOT FREEZE.
    • Protect from light exposure to preserve reagent stability.
  • Handling Precautions:
    • Use pipette tips with aerosol barriers to prevent contamination.
    • Work in a clean, DNA-free environment to avoid false positives.
  • Disposal Guidelines:
    • Dispose of according to local biosafety and chemical waste disposal regulations.
